We own a camper and although we don't want to bring a camping table with us, we still would like to eat outdoors.
My space-saving solution works well for two people.
I used a metal hinge to screw a laminated wooden panel to the backside of the kitchen cabinet.
Then I screwed three CSN-25
pot magnets (four might have been even better) close together to the bottom side of the panel.
I embedded a CSN-ES-16
pot magnet in the top side of the panel and used a metal disc 23 mm
as counterpart on the kitchen cabinet, so the panel is secured when folded up (see photo above).
Note from the supermagnete team: Since a pot magnet is embedded in the table top, you need to keep electronic devices away to avoid damages.
